Title: The Importance of Exercising for Physical and Mental Well-being

Regular exercise plays a crucial role in promoting physical and mental well-being. Engaging in physical activity not only helps maintain weight and prevent chronic illnesses, but it also boosts mood and reduces stress levels. This article explores the significance of exercising and how it positively impacts overall health.

Firstly, exercise is vital for managing weight and preventing obesity. Engaging in physical activities, such as jogging, swimming, or cycling, can burn calories and help maintain a healthy body weight. Regular exercise also increases metabolism, allowing the body to efficiently convert food into energy.

By incorporating exercise into one's routine, individuals can promote healthy weight management and reduce the risk of obesity-related health conditions like heart disease, diabetes, and hypertension.

In addition to physical benefits, exercise is also known to have a positive impact on mental health. Engaging in regular physical activity stimulates the release of endorphins, also known as "feel-good" hormones. These endorphins boost mood, alleviate symptoms of depression and anxiety, and enhance overall mental well-being. Exercise has been shown to reduce stress levels by reducing cortisol, a hormone associated with stress.

In this way, exercise acts as a natural and effective stress reliever, offering a healthy alternative to cope with everyday pressures.

Moreover, exercise plays a significant role in improving cardiovascular health. Regular physical activity strengthens the heart, making it more efficient in pumping blood and delivering oxygen to the rest of the body. Exercise also helps lower blood pressure, reduces bad cholesterol levels, and increases good cholesterol, thus reducing the risk of heart disease and stroke. By incorporating exercises like running, brisk walking, or aerobics, individuals can improve their cardiovascular fitness and overall heart health.

Furthermore, exercise promotes better sleep patterns. Engaging in physical activity during the day helps burn excess energy, making it easier to fall asleep and improve the quality of sleep. Regular exercise has been shown to regulate sleep patterns, making individuals feel more rested and refreshed upon waking up. A good night's sleep is crucial for optimal physical and mental functioning, as it allows the body to repair and regenerate cells, and helps improve cognitive functions such as memory and concentration.

In conclusion, regular exercise is a vital component of maintaining physical and mental well-being.

Engaging in physical activities not only helps manage weight, prevent chronic diseases, and enhance cardiovascular health, but it also boosts mood, reduces stress levels, and promotes better sleep patterns. Incorporating exercise into one's daily routine is a key factor in leading a healthier and happier life.
